Five Below VP of Product Salary

The average Five Below VP of Product earns an estimated $240,935 annually, which includes an estimated base salary of $191,615 with a $49,320 bonus. Five Below's VP of Product compensation is $113,034 less than the US average for a VP of Product. VP of Product salaries at Five Below can range from $125,599 - $433,000.

The Product Department at Five Below earns $2,218 more on average than the Legal Department.
